Comparative genetic linkage map for Solanum ochranthum and S. juglandifolium and genetic diversity and population structure in S. lycopersicoides and S. sitiens
The four nightshades Solanum ochranthum, S. juglandifolium, S. lycopersicoides and S. sitiens compose the basal ranks of the tomato clade ( S. sect. lycopersicum and S. sect. juglandifolium ), representing a link between cultivated potato ( S. tuberosum ) and cultivated tomato ( S. lycopersicum ). Data from: Constraint around quarter-power allometric scaling in wild tomatoes (Solanum sect. Lycopersicon; Solanaceae)
The West-Brown-Enquist (WBE) metabolic scaling theory posits that many organismal features scale predictably with body size because of selection to minimize transport costs in resource distribution networks.
